Custom iOS App Development: What Enterprises Should Expect
- Niraj Jagwani
- Mar 26
- 9 min read

In the digital-first era, iOS app development has emerged as a critical piece for businesses to reach premium users, increase productivity, and fuel growth. With more than a billion active Apple devices worldwide, iOS offers a profitable avenue for businesses to provide high-quality mobile experiences.
As business mobility solutions become more critical, demand for bespoke mobile app development has increased. Ready-to-use applications hardly fulfill the specific operational, security, and scalability needs of big enterprises. Enterprises need custom-made solutions that fit their individual workflows, data infrastructure, and long-term objectives. This is where custom iOS app development excels—offering organizations complete control over functionality, design, and performance.
Additionally, as the expectations of customers continue to change, businesses need to adopt apps that are not just visually attractive but also safe, quick, and significantly integrated into current systems. This has raised the demand for expert iOS development firms that can provide top-end, scalable applications using innovative technologies like Swift app development services.
From healthcare to fintech, retail to logistics, companies are quickly using custom iOS applications to establish a competitive edge, automate internal operations, and provide better services to their customers. If your business is looking to invest in a custom iOS solution, this is an in-depth guide on what to anticipate and how to select the correct partner.
What Enterprises Should Expect from Custom iOS App Development?
A. Tailored Solutions
Unlike standard apps, custom iOS apps are designed ground-up to fulfill an enterprise's specific needs. That is, every feature, every design component, and workflow is designed-to-order to streamline efficiency and achieve user expectations. Custom apps yield greater user adoption, less friction, and, typically, superior ROI.
B. Expertise in Swift Development
New-generation iOS apps are developed almost entirely with Swift, Apple's powerful and intuitive programming language. Enterprises can expect their development partner to provide Swift app development services for secure, reliable, and maintainable apps. Swift's performance and safety features make it a perfect fit to develop enterprise-level solutions.
C. End-to-End Support
A trusted iOS app development company will offer end-to-end lifecycle support—right from ideation and design through deployment and maintenance. This encompasses periodic updates, performance tracking, and adding new features to ensure the app remains business-aligned.
D. Focus on Security and Compliance
Businesses work in highly regulated sectors and need apps that focus on data security, user privacy, and adherence to regulations such as GDPR, HIPAA, or PCI-DSS. Custom iOS apps must incorporate secure authentication, encryption, and device management to reduce risks.
Choosing the Right iOS Development Company
When considering potential partners for your iOS project, don't just look at surface-level capabilities. Here's what to consider:
Proven Experience: Select a company with a solid background in iOS app development, particularly for enterprise clients. Complex use cases and high-scale deployments are most important.
Portfolio of Successful Apps: Check out their app portfolio to evaluate design quality, performance, and success stories in the real world.
Swift Expertise: Make sure the team is highly proficient in Swift app development services, as it is highly important for performance, security, and future-proofing your app.
Client Testimonials: Satisfying references and reviews of previous enterprise clients give important lessons in reliability, professionalism, and support quality.
Choosing the right partner will greatly impact the success of your custom app. Prioritize companies that understand enterprise workflows and can align technology solutions with your strategic goals.
Understanding Custom iOS App Development
Custom iOS app development refers to the process of developing customized mobile applications that are tailored to address the specific needs of an enterprise or company. In contrast to off-the-shelf, generic solutions, custom apps are developed from scratch, taking into account user needs, business goals, and scalability requirements. This customized method allows organizations to develop applications that fit their operational purposes to the letter and give them a competitive advantage in the marketplace.
What is Custom Mobile App Development?
Custom mobile app development is all about creating apps that are completely customized to solve particular problems or opportunities a company is facing. It entails working very closely with an iOS development firm to establish requirements, design special features, and create a user experience that speaks to the target audience. For example, a retail business may need an app with an extremely interactive shopping experience, live inventory status updates, and effortless integration with its current ERP system. Custom apps guarantee these requirements are fulfilled without any compromise.
This kind of development also utilizes the newest technologies, including Swift app development services, to develop powerful, efficient, and secure apps. The application of new programming languages and frameworks enables companies to remain ahead of the competition, providing superior performance and a top-notch user experience.
The Difference Between Off-the-Shelf and Custom Apps
Off-the-shelf applications are pre-configured software solutions that serve a broad base of users and industries. Off-the-shelf applications are readily deployable but limited in customization capabilities. Although they can be inexpensive and rapid to deploy, off-the-shelf applications are generally not flexible enough to meet particular business needs. For instance, an off-the-shelf customer relationship management (CRM) application may not easily integrate with the proprietary software of an organization or accommodate exceptional workflows.
Custom apps, however, are built with a sole intent on the requirements of the organization. They provide unmatched flexibility since companies can include specific features, functionalities, and integrations that suit their objectives. This customized approach also guarantees that the app will grow and change along with the business, supporting future growth and shifting needs.
At its core, bespoke mobile app development is the process of designing a solution that not only addresses present problems but also lays the foundation for long-term success. Through investment in customized iOS applications, businesses are able to differentiate themselves in an aggressive marketplace and give users an experience that stands out.
What Enterprises Should Expect from an iOS Development Company?
When companies invest in iOS app development, selecting the right development partner is key to the long-term success of their mobile initiative. An established iOS development firm doesn't only create apps—it is a strategic technology partner that helps enterprises navigate every phase of the mobile app lifecycle. This is what companies ought to expect from a sound and professional development firm:
Strategic Consultation & Requirement Analysis
The process starts with a complete understanding of the business, its objectives, and pain areas. A professional iOS development firm will have in-depth consultation meetings with stakeholders to examine particular business needs, user requirements, and market prospects. This step forms the basis for mapping app features and functionalities with business goals. Strategic consultation guarantees that the final product is not just technically robust but also in sync with business KPIs.
UI/UX Design Tailored to Business Goals
User experience matters, particularly for business apps that require driving interaction and productivity. A proficient iOS development team will deliver UI/UX design services grounded in both creativity and business objectives. The aim is to develop interfaces that are intuitive, accessible, and visually consistent with the brand's identity. From prototyping to user testing, all aspects are custom-designed to provide a seamless experience to end-users—be it internal teams or customers.
Swift and Objective-C Expert Development
The development phase core is where your app lives. A professional iOS development company brings extensive knowledge in both Swift—Apple's up-to-date, modern programming language—and Objective-C, still running many older systems. They know when to deploy each, or how to do both at the same time to achieve best performance, scalability, and compatibility. Swift application development services are specially critical to create secure, speed, and future-proof applications.
Scalability and Performance Optimization
Flawless functioning is required by enterprise-class apps, even in increasing usage. A reliable iOS development partner shall create apps which are scalable as well as speed, reliability, and responsiveness optimized. They implement backend architecture, database design, and API integration to sustain peak traffic, enhanced datasets, as well as demanding user interactions. Battery efficiency, memory management, and minimisation of app crashing or loading duration are also parts of performance optimization.
Post-Launch Support and Updates
Collaboration with an iOS app development company shouldn't be the end of it. Support post-launch is needed to keep the app updated with the newest versions of iOS, security updates, and user opinions. This consists of routine maintenance, performance checking, and iterative enhancement. Post-launch services also encompass bug fixing, feature enhancement, and technical support to promote long-term success and user happiness.
The Role of Swift in Custom App Development
Swift has quickly emerged as the programming language of choice for iOS app development, and for a good reason. Launched by Apple in 2014 as a replacement for Objective-C, Swift has changed app development for iOS, macOS, watchOS, and tvOS. Its compact syntax, robust performance, and safety-oriented design have earned it the status of the default language of choice for enterprises looking to invest in bespoke mobile app development.
One of the most important reasons Swift is popular in the enterprise world is its performance optimization. Swift is built to be fast — both execution and development speed. It reduces many of the typical coding mistakes present in older languages by providing strong typing, error handling, and memory safety features. This minimizes runtime crashes and increases the stability of enterprise-level applications, which is important for enterprises handling large amounts of data, confidential information, and mission-critical operations.
Security is yet another important reason Swift is given top priority in business environments. It provides sophisticated error handling, optionals, and strict type safety, which makes it significantly more difficult for developers to code insecurely. These capabilities, along with Apple's strong security architecture, enable Swift app development services to provide apps that are highly compliant with stringent compliance requirements and data protection laws — a requirement in sectors such as finance, healthcare, and government.
In addition, Swift provides effortless integration with Apple's ecosystem and state-of-the-art APIs, allowing developers to create bespoke features specific to enterprise requirements. Whether it's integrating with Apple Pay, HealthKit, or taking advantage of machine learning with Core ML, Swift allows developers to create innovative, secure, and high-performance apps.
In the realm of bespoke iOS app development, it makes strategic sense to partner with an iOS development firm that has expertise in Swift. These firms have in-depth knowledge of harnessing the language's potential, making the app not just usable but scalable, maintainable, and future-proof. At its core, Swift is not so much a language — it's an enabling tool that enables businesses to realize their digital aspirations through customized, secure, and resilient iOS apps.
Key Features Enterprises Should Prioritize
Enterprise-Level Security
Security is of top priority for businesses, particularly when dealing with sensitive information like customer data, financial data, or confidential business procedures. Enterprise-level security guarantees data protection through stringent measures such as end-to-end encryption, secure authentication mechanisms, and sophisticated monitoring systems. Features like Mobile Device Management (MDM) offer corporate device control centrally, enforcing security policy compliance and remote data wiping in the event of loss or theft. Using tools like multi-factor authentication (MFA) and zero-trust security models can also add to the integrity of enterprise systems. Businesses also need to give priority to compliance with sector-specific regulations, such as GDPR or HIPAA, to minimise chances of legal penalties and reputation loss.
Integration with Legacy Systems and APIs
Enterprises tend to lean on legacy systems for core operations, and smooth integration is a must in such cases. Compatibility with legacy systems and APIs enables businesses to leverage their past technology investments and add more functionality using contemporary tools. Integration diminishes data silos, optimizes workflow, and facilitates cross-functional collaboration. For example, enterprise applications with API support can integrate with CRM systems, ERP platforms, or supply chain solutions, facilitating real-time data exchange and insights. Enterprises are left vulnerable to operational inefficiencies and lost opportunities for innovation without sound integration capabilities.
Analytics and Reporting Dashboards
Data-driven decision making is the hallmark of contemporary enterprises. Reporting dashboards and analytics provide businesses with actionable insights through aggregating convoluted data into visual, understandable formats. Real-time dashboards enable keeping an eye on key performance metrics (KPIs), uncovering trends, and making timely decisions. Platforms providing customizable dashboards, predictive analytics, and drill-down ability should be searched for by the enterprises. They not only enhance transparency but also encourage proactive management by pointing toward possible challenges or growth opportunities.
Offline Capabilities
Offline functionality is essential for preserving productivity in settings with variable or poor internet connectivity. Enterprise software with offline support enables local access, editing, and storage of data, automatically syncing this when the connection resumes. This is particularly valuable for businesses such as logistics, field engineering, or retail, where workers might work regularly in remote areas. By providing seamless access to essential tools and data, offline functionality minimizes downtime and maximizes working efficiency.
Scalability for Growing User Base
Scalability is essential for enterprises planning for long-term growth. Solutions that can accommodate an increasing number of users, devices, and data volumes without compromising performance ensure that businesses remain agile and future-ready. Cloud-based platforms are particularly advantageous, offering elastic scaling to handle fluctuating demands cost-effectively. Scalability also involves the system's ability to support new functionalities and integrations as business needs evolve. Businesses should focus on scalable infrastructure to prevent expensive overhauls or constraints when there is rapid growth.
Through emphasis on these characteristics, businesses can establish solid, efficient, and future-proof systems that meet their strategic objectives and business needs.
Conclusion
In an era where digital transformation determines competitive edge, bespoke iOS app development isn't a nicety—it's a strategic necessity. Businesses can no longer settle for off-the-shelf apps that don't take into account their individual requirements and growth objectives.
A well-designed custom iOS app does more than digitize your business processes; it empowers teams, delights customers, and drives innovation. Whether you’re streamlining internal workflows, building a customer-facing app, or launching a new digital product, tailored iOS solutions ensure your investment is aligned with your long-term vision.
Selecting the optimal iOS development partner—firm with clear success, Swift proficiency, and collaborative culture—is the path to success. Don't shop based on price; shop based on value, skill set, and goals alignment.